Current version:
- Expose <android/log.h> containing the stable declarations of liblog.so,
which can be used to send log messages to the kernel.
- Force the use of 32-bit toolchain binaries on 64-bit hosts. This reduces
the number of prebuilt packages needed to be distributed.
- Expose the zlib headers <zlib.h> and <zconf.h> as part of the stable
ABIs.
- Use the --no-undefined flag at link time by default when generating
binaries. This means that the linker will issue an "undefined symbol"
error when trying to build a shared library that references an undefined
variable or function. This is to help catch simple bugs, but you can
override this by setting LOCAL_ALLOW_UNDEFINED_SYMBOLS to true.
- Fix a typo that prevented APP_CFLAGS, APP_CPPFLAGS, etc.. to work as
advertized in the build system.
- Fix auto-dependency computations
- Fix dependency between the generated shared libraries and the copy that
is installed in under the application's project path.
- "make APP=<app> clean" now properly cleans the installed binaries.
- Fix the build-toolchain.sh to refer to the proper download location for the
toolchain source tarball.
